WebTake their temperature. If it’s the winter months or colder weather (below about 50°F) then anything above 101.5°F will be feverish for most goats. In the warmer months, my mark is 102.5°F before I concern myself. Record … WebFeb 11, 2024 · Step 1: Observe Goats and Environment. WebCoughing can be caused by something as simple as the goat's eating or drinking too fast. Humans cannot become infected by lungworms and meat from infected goats is safe for human consumption. There are two ways to diagnose lungworms: (1) Baerman fecal testing, which is a somewhat tricky fecal sedimentation procedure that is easy to perform ...
